Heart of Texas Behavioral Health Network Limestone County Center in Mexia, TX, is a leading rehabilitation facility offering a wide range of services to support individuals in their journey towards recovery. Specializing in alcohol and smoking cessation, as well as addressing issues such as anger management, trauma, substance abuse including methamphetamine, cocaine, and marijuana, self-harm, stress, and depression, the center provides comprehensive care tailored to meet the unique needs of each individual. With a focus on outpatient services, Heart of Texas Behavioral Health Network welcomes men, women, teens, and children, accepting Medicaid, Medicare, SAMHSA, private health insurance, as well as cash or self-payment options.

About Medicaid

Medicaid is a joint federal and state program that provides health insurance to low-income individuals and families, ensuring access to essential medical services. Established in 1965 alongside Medicare, Medicaid is funded by both federal and state governments, with the federal government matching state expenditures based on a formula that considers the state's per capita income. As of 2023, Medicaid covers over 75 million Americans, including eligible low-income adults, children, pregnant women, elderly adults, and people with disabilities. The program offers a comprehensive range of benefits, such as inpatient and outpatient hospital services, physician services, laboratory and X-ray services, home health services, and long-term care. Medicaid is crucial in reducing healthcare disparities, improving health outcomes, and providing a safety net for the most vulnerable populations in the United States.

Mexia - Texas

Mexia ( muh-HAY-uh) or ( meh-HAY-uh) is a city in Limestone County, Texas, United States. The population was 6,893 at the 2020 census. The city's motto, based on the fact that outsiders tend to mispronounce the name as (MEK-see-ə), is "A great place to live, no matter how you pronounce it.
